One Person Killed on Vermont-Slauson 

March 26, 2024 - Vermont-Slauson, CA - Los Angeles Police Department officials report that the South Bureau Homicide detectives LAPD logoare asking for the public’s help in identifying the suspect, or suspects, responsible for the shooting death of one victim.

On March 19, 2024, around 8:50 p.m., 77th Area patrol officers responded to a radio call of a “victim down” in the 5800 block of South Hoover Street.

When the officers arrived, they located the victim, a 24-year-old female, in the roadway suffering from a gunshot wound. There was evidence that the victim had also been struck by a vehicle. The Los Angeles City Fire Department responded and pronounced the victim deceased at scene.

Anyone with additional information is urged to contact South Bureau Homicide Division detectives at (323) 786-5100.
